LIVE REVIEW: The 9th Annual Ravo Blues & Roots Festival featuring Diesel, Ross Wilson, Dave Hole, 19-Twenty, Vdelli and many more

RAVENSWOOD HOTEL, WA - Saturday 17th February 2024

Diesel

The 9th Annual Ravo Bluesfest at Ravenswood Hotel proved to be an unforgettable celebration of Australian Blues music, set against the picturesque backdrop of the Murray River. With twelve amazing acts spread across two stages, the venue’s natural affinity for blues music shone through, creating an immersive experience for the capacity crowd.

Local talents such as Terminal 3, Hope River Road, The Australian Van Morrison Show, and Jason Ayres with Morgan Joanel kicked off the festivities, setting the bar high with their captivating performances. Each act held their own on stage, leaving the audience thoroughly impressed and eager for more.

Adding another cheeky dash of Western Australian flavour, Vdelli, Proud Mary and legendary slide guitarist Dave Hole showcased their skills, further highlighting the depth and diversity of Australian Blues music.

The line-up continued to impress with interstate champions like Busby Marou, 19-Twenty, Hussy Hicks, Diesel, and Daddy Cool himself, Ross Wilson, delivering stellar performances that kept the crowd engaged and energized throughout the night.

Starr Special Events Australia once again delivered with their impeccable organization and attention to detail, ensuring that no one in the audience left without feeling a sense of amazement at the spectacle they had witnessed. From the seamless flow between stages to the top-notch performances, it was clear that this event was something truly special.
